Examination and Pre-Op ExpensesWhen considering the cost of breast augmentation, the first step generally involves the assessment and pre-operative costs. During the appointment, you'll meet with your cosmetic surgeon to review your goals, assumptions, and any kind of concerns you might have. This is an important action in the process as it enables the surgeon to assess your suitability for the procedure and recommend the best strategy.
The consultation cost may differ depending on the doctor's experience and place. Usually, you can expect to pay in between $50 to $500 for this preliminary consultation.
Additionally, there might be expenses connected with pre-operative tests such as blood work, mammograms, and various other analyses to ensure you remain in health for surgery. These examinations are crucial for your safety and security and can range from $200 to $500.
Surgical Procedure Costs and AnesthesiaAfter resolving the consultation and pre-operative prices, the next financial aspect to take into consideration for breast augmentation is the surgery costs and anesthetic. These charges commonly cover the cost of the operating room, surgical tools, and the cosmetic surgeon's cost. The surgical treatment charges can differ based upon the complexity of the treatment, the surgeon's experience, and the geographic area of the technique.
Anesthetic expenses are likewise included in this group and can be influenced by whether a board-certified anesthesiologist or a nurse anesthetist administers the anesthesia.
The surgical procedure costs and anesthesia are crucial components of your breast augmentation budget. When seeking advice from your plastic surgeon, make certain to ask about the break down of these prices to recognize what's included. Some practices may supply package deals that combine the surgical treatment fees and anesthetic prices.

Post-Operative Care and Revision CostsFor your breast augmentation trip, thinking about the prices of post-operative care and prospective modification procedures is crucial for an extensive budget strategy. Post-operative treatment costs usually consist of medicines, post-surgical garments, and follow-up consultations. It's important to allocate pain drugs, prescription antibiotics, and any type of special garments required for appropriate healing. Revision treatments are another element to consider. While unusual, they may be needed for changes or improvements after the preliminary surgical treatment. Revision expenses can differ extensively depending upon the degree of the treatment needed. Factors such as implant replacement, scar alteration, or addressing any problems can add to these costs. It's a good idea to reserve funds for potential alteration treatments to stay clear of financial pressure if they come to be essential.
Ensure to discuss with your doctor what revision plans remain in place and how they may influence your spending plan preparation.
